| Index: Source/platform/graphics/Canvas2DImageBufferSurface.h
|
| diff --git a/Source/platform/graphics/Canvas2DImageBufferSurface.h b/Source/platform/graphics/Canvas2DImageBufferSurface.h
|
| index e14bb5d94246445d8620488bc0b07da2d10553c0..279d4f8a04471e484b3e4687815b58eebc66c2cd 100644
|
| --- a/Source/platform/graphics/Canvas2DImageBufferSurface.h
|
| +++ b/Source/platform/graphics/Canvas2DImageBufferSurface.h
|
| @@ -39,9 +39,9 @@ namespace WebCore {
|
| // This shim necessary because ImageBufferSurfaces are not allowed to be RefCounted
|
| class Canvas2DImageBufferSurface : public ImageBufferSurface {
|
| public:
|
| - Canvas2DImageBufferSurface(const IntSize& size, OpacityMode opacityMode = NonOpaque, int msaaSampleCount = 1)
|
| + Canvas2DImageBufferSurface(Canvas2DLayerBridgeClient* client, const IntSize& size, OpacityMode opacityMode = NonOpaque, int msaaSampleCount = 1)
|
| : ImageBufferSurface(size, opacityMode)
|
| - , m_layerBridge(Canvas2DLayerBridge::create(size, opacityMode, msaaSampleCount))
|
| + , m_layerBridge(Canvas2DLayerBridge::create(client, size, opacityMode, msaaSampleCount))
|
| {
|
| clear();
|
| }
|
|
|